Supreme Court Decision in Favor of 
Los Angeles County Sheriff's Deputies
Los Angeles, May 30, 2017 - The U.S. Supreme Court today sided with Los Angeles County sheriff's deputies and threw out a lower court ruling.  After the ruling, ALADS issued the following statement:
 
ALADS is grateful a unanimous United States Supreme Court rejected the "provocation rule" created by the 9th Circuit to judge use of force by deputies. This invented rule put the lives of deputies in danger by causing them to hesitate in using reasonable force to defend themselves for fear of later civil liability. The Supreme Court decision is a strong reaffirmation that any use of force will be judged solely based on the facts known to the deputies at the time force was employed.
